Playground Designer

American Society of Interior Designers, Dallas, TX, United States


Overview
Playit Creations is a fun, creative place to work with a great team and amazing products!

The commercial Playground Division of Weldit Metalworks Inc: (Playit Creations), is seeking a talented Mechanical/Industrial Design Engineer to join our team of talented creators and fabricators.

Position Details & Expectations

Expected to perform a wide range of tasks across the life cycle of project creation (from 2D drafting, prototyping, and revisions, to accurate 3D models & functional shop drawings for fabrication)

Ideal candidate is somebody that has 2+ years of experience in mechanical, industrial, or structural design, engineering or equivalent.

This is an area of growth in our company and are open to implementing new technologies and techniques, but the candidate must have a strong understanding of both 2D & 3D CAD programs

AutoCAD (2D Drafting - Preferred)

SolidWorks (3D - Preferred; but Autodesk Fusion 360 would also be great.)

3DS Max (3D - Preferred)

Google Sketchup will not be accepted

Applicant must have a humble, consistently positive attitude and be eager to work respectfully and harmoniously in a team environment.

Has a basic understanding of working with custom metal fabrication, production processes and manufacturing techniques (required).

Duties & Responsibilities

Use sound design principles and best‑practice CAD methods while working on projects and creating documentation.

Efficiently balance several projects at once, being able to pivot when necessary.

Help to design & develop products that meet cost and timeline needs.

Create accurate 3D CAD models and engineering drawings.

Create documentation that can be used to fabricate products with very little explanation/oversight on the manufacturing floor.

Work closely with Sales, Marketing and New Product Development to coordinate new products and understand product designs.

Able to functionally Project Manage, providing real‑time reporting of assigned project progress.

Develop and maintain an organized CAD block library of Plan view and Elevation CAD blocks based upon renderings created in the Design Department.

Create 3D structural frames using AutoCAD or similar software based on design parameters.

Create plan view layouts by utilizing pre‑designed CAD blocks and creating custom made blocks on‑demand.

Verify product design accuracy based upon specifications, codes, and other regulations.

A general knowledge of basic construction methods and manufacturing is expected.

Create and maintain a library of Product Manufacturing’s drawing job folders.

Requirements

Fluent with AutoCAD 2D and a commonly used 3D CAD program, such as Autodesk Fusion 360, SolidWorks, or Autodesk 3DS Max

Fluent with Adobe Creative Cloud (specifically InDesign, Illustrator, Photoshop)

Must be experienced with Microsoft Office including basic Excel

Must be organized and detail oriented.

Bachelor’s degree in engineering, industrial design (or similar), or Technical School with successful experience.

Must always maintain confidentiality.

Ability to work independently without becoming distracted or wasting time.

Ability to locate and process data efficiently and with a sense of urgency.

Ability to work on a PC.

Proficient problem‑solving skills, writing skills, and math skills.

Expected to work 40+ hours per week.
